Key Neighborhoods in Marlboro

Marlboro Township is comprised of several distinct neighborhoods, each with its own unique character and appeal. Exploring these neighborhoods can help you find the perfect fit for your lifestyle:

  • Robertsville: Known for its beautiful homes and spacious lots, Robertsville offers a tranquil suburban setting. It's a desirable area for families seeking a peaceful environment with easy access to amenities. The properties in Robertsville often feature well-maintained landscapes and a sense of privacy. The neighborhood's charm and convenience make it a popular choice among buyers.
  • Morganville: Morganville is a vibrant and diverse community with a mix of housing options and a thriving business district. It offers a convenient lifestyle with shopping, dining, and entertainment options close by. The area's accessibility and amenities make it an attractive place to live. Morganville provides a balance of residential and commercial spaces.
  • Bradford Manor: This neighborhood features well-maintained homes and a strong sense of community. It's a popular choice for families and those seeking a close-knit environment. The pride of ownership is evident in the neighborhood's manicured lawns and welcoming atmosphere. Bradford Manor offers a peaceful and family-friendly setting.

Tips for Finding Houses for Sale in Marlboro, NJ

Finding the right home in Marlboro requires a strategic approach. Here are some tips to help you in your search:

  • Work with a Local Real Estate Agent: A knowledgeable real estate agent can provide valuable insights into the Marlboro market, help you find properties that meet your criteria, and guide you through the buying process. They can also negotiate on your behalf and ensure your interests are protected. An agent's expertise is invaluable in navigating the complexities of the real estate market.
  • Get Pre-Approved for a Mortgage: Getting pre-approved for a mortgage can give you a clear understanding of your budget and make you a more attractive buyer to sellers. It also streamlines the financing process and helps you move quickly when you find the right property. Pre-approval demonstrates your financial readiness and seriousness to potential sellers.
  • Use Online Resources: Utilize online resources such as real estate websites and listing portals to search for properties and gather information. These platforms provide access to a vast database of listings, allowing you to explore different options and compare prices. Online tools can help you narrow your search and identify properties that meet your needs.
  • Attend Open Houses: Attending open houses is a great way to view properties in person and get a feel for different neighborhoods. It also allows you to meet with real estate agents and ask questions about specific listings. Open houses provide an opportunity to assess properties firsthand and visualize yourself living in them.
  • Be Prepared to Act Quickly: The Marlboro real estate market can be competitive, so it's important to be prepared to act quickly when you find a property you like. This means having your financing in place and being ready to make an offer. A swift response can increase your chances of securing the property you desire. Timeliness is crucial in a competitive market.
